Plaza del Padre Javier
Plaza del Padre Javier is in Fuente del Maestre, Badajoz, Extremadura. Plaza del Padre Javier is situated nearby to the church Ermita de Nuestra Señora del Buen Suceso, as well as near the bus station Parada de Autobuses.Places in the Area

Fuente del Maestre is a municipality in the province of Badajoz, Extremadura, Spain. It has a population of 6,943 and an area of 180 km2.

Villafranca de los Barros is a municipality in the province of Badajoz, Extremadura, Spain. It has a population of 13,329 and an area of 104 km2. Villafranca de los Barros is situated 10 km northeast of Plaza del Padre Javier.

Los Santos de Maimona is a municipality in the province of Badajoz, Extremadura, Spain. It has an area of 108 km2. In 2018, the population was 8,126. Los Santos de Maimona is situated 10 km southeast of Plaza del Padre Javier.
